Enable job alerts via email!

Senior Software Engineer

invygo

United Arab Emirates

On-site

AED 120,000 - 160,000

Full time

4 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in the MENA region is seeking a product-minded Senior Engineer to enhance their software development practices. The role involves designing and delivering innovative solutions while collaborating with a dynamic team. Ideal candidates will have strong analytical skills, mentorship experience, and a customer-centric approach to problem-solving.

Qualifications

  • Experience in a collaborative, customer-centric environment.
  • Strong focus on simple solutions and iterative development.

Responsibilities

  • Design, write, and deliver software while improving platform reliability.
  • Coach junior engineers through pair programming and code reviews.
  • Deliver value to customers by understanding their needs.

Skills

Analytical Skills
Problem-Solving
Communication
Mentorship

Job description

About Invygo

Invygo was founded in 2018 in Dubai with the purpose of redefining mobility in the Middle East and North Africa (MENA). Fuelled by a passion for innovation, technology, and mobility, our mission is to empower people to move on their own terms, minimising the frustrations caused by traditional car ownership models. We make car access seamless and flexible for everyone. We believe invygo is the smartest way to move, and to keep living up to our ideal, we rely on our people to share these goals and ambitions.

Headquartered in Dubai, with offices in Riyadh and Cairo, our team consists of passionate, dedicated, bold innovators who are relentless in enabling the company to deliver a trusted and personalised experience that transforms how people move in MENA. With successful expansions into UAE, Saudi Arabia, and Qatar, our footprint is rapidly growing as we continue to innovate and transform the automotive landscape across the region.

At invygo, we're not just offering a service; we're crafting a new era of mobility in MENA. We are always seeking passionate, dedicated, and innovative thinkers to join us in making our future vision a reality. If you are that person, join us in moving the MENA mobility landscape forward and ensuring that invygo remains the smartest way to move.

About The Role

We seek a product-minded Senior Engineer with a solid foundation in development practices and continuous delivery to join our dynamic team. In this role, you will be responsible for designing, writing, and delivering software while closely collaborating with your team members. Your contributions to evolving legacy codebases and implementing innovative solutions will drive our products to new heights, aligning them with business objectives and customer needs.

Responsibilities
Development & Emergent Design Practices
  • Design, write, and deliver software while improving the reliability and stability of our platform
  • Evaluate and modernise legacy systems, implementing strategies to refine our technology stack
  • Drive the adoption of best practices in development and design, ensuring innovative and practical solutions
  • Experience in TDD, Pair Programming, Continuous Refactoring, and Simple Design is a plus
Collaboration and Mentorship
  • Coach junior engineers through pair programming, code reviews, and brown bag sessions
  • Act as a role model in fostering effective teamwork and communication
  • Collaborate with team members to make sound decisions
  • Cultivate a collaborative team culture that values innovative thinking and continuous improvement
Product Mindset
  • Deliver value to customers by understanding their needs and crafting practical solutions
Requirements
  • Experience working in a collaborative, customer-centric environment
  • Strong focus on simple solutions and iterative development to reduce complexity and optimize engineering capacity
  • Experience with modernising codebases and successful incremental improvements
  • Good mentorship skills and ability to inspire technical decision-making
  • Strong analytical and problem-solving skills with customer-driven solutions
  • Excellent communication and interpersonal skills
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.